The most popular majors at Compton College, measured by the number of graduates, are listed below.

Most Popular Majors Graduates
Multi-Disciplinary Studies 1,265
Liberal Arts and Sciences, General Studies and Humanities. 823
Biological and Physical Sciences. 81
Cosmetology and Related Personal Grooming Services. 72
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ing. 64
